catonano07:11:48

How do I write a huge file in clojure ? It's about 1.3 Gb

catonano07:11:40

I'm having an error OutOfMemoryError Java heap space  clojure.lang.PersistentVector$TransientVector.editableTail (PersistentVector.java:564)

catonano07:11:10

previously I used data.csv to write csv files. Now I'd like to write a file in a specific format

catonano07:11:38

I copied the data.csv function to write it (with the loop recur and all) but still...

catonano07:11:44

What am I not getting ?

@catonano: I the first version looks sensible. I does not hold the head of line. How is lines generated? Can you call (last line) without an error?

ordnungswidrig09:11:23

@roelof: sort of description?

catonano09:11:47

@ordnungswidrig: I try, just a minute

roelof09:11:32

@ordnungswidrig: I try to make a little financial toy app and I like to see that the user calls the function like this : (deposit 1000 "Withdraw from the bank on 01-10-2015 ". So later on I could make a report on all the transactions

catonano09:11:44

@ordnungswidrig: no, I can't call (last lines) without the same error showing up

catonano09:11:07

so the culprit is not the code writing the file !

catonano09:11:13

i just arranged some transducers, the I called (into [] my-transducer original-collection)

ordnungswidrig09:11:32

@roelof: i see, you might want to do sth. like (send account conj {:amount 100 :desc „money!“})

catonano09:11:23

I assumed that (into []... produced a lazy thing

catonano09:11:51

I'm using sequence now and it has written more than 2 Gb so far !

I don’t know that anyone has enough experience with Om.Next yet to compare it to Reagent. Based on what I saw at Clojure/conj, I think I’d still prefer Reagent — Om.Next still looks more OO and a little too opinionated for my taste but it’s a big change from Om in several of its core concepts.

nando20:11:44

What I like about om.next from what I understand (purely on a conceptual level) is that it is not necessary to build a complex nested data structure for a complex nested ui.

nando20:11:20

@nando: We used Sente which provided core.async channels over WebSockets

nando21:11:55

Ah, ok. Now I remember. This time I will write it down! Thanks

roelof21:11:55

@nando: im now thinking how to flatten a seq without using flatten, that one im not allowed to use

seancorfield21:11:03

That meant that we could just use core.async for pushing messages around the application — both client and server — without worrying about actually making API calls.

nando21:11:12

@roelof - which problem is that?

seancorfield21:11:43

Everything was asynchronous: a component could ask for data by sending a message containing a "tag" (representing where the data should go in the client state) and a "query" (whatever the app understood); the server would read the message, dispatch it based on the contents of the query, that would lead to a message being sent back to the connected client(s) containing the data, which would cause the client state to update (which would trigger a re-render).
